Analysis

In 2023, pesticides manufacturing — emissions in India stood at 7,030 kt.

Compared with earlier readings it is down 9.5% on the previous year and up 103.5% over ten years.

Over the whole period, pesticides manufacturing — emissions in India peaked at 7,771 kt in 2022 and was at its lowest, 1,572 kt, in 2008.

That places India 6th out of 218 countries with data for 2023, putting it in the top 10%.

The series is highly variable year to year, so single readings are best treated with caution.

The FAOSTAT domain on Emissions from Pre- and post- agricultural production includes the greenhouse gas (GHG) emissions, and related activity data, generated from pre- and post-agriculture production stages of the agri-food syst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). The domain includes methane (CH4), nitrous oxide (N2O), carbon dioxide (CO2) and CO2 equivalent (CO2eq) emissions from the above activities as well as the aggregate fluorinated gases (F-gases) emissions. Estimates are available by country, with global coverage and are updated annually.The FAOSTAT domain disseminates information estimates of CH4, N2O, CO2 emissions, F-gases, their aggregates in CO2eq in units of kilotonnes (kt, or 10^6 kg), and the underlying activity data. CO2eq emissions are computed by using the IPCC Fifth Assessment report global warming potentials, AR5 (IPCC, 2014). Data are available for most countries and territories, for standard FAOSTAT regional aggregations, and for Annex I and non-Annex I country groups.
